Show / Hide Table of Contents

Class ReusableConfigWrapper

A [ReusableConfigWrapper][google.cloud.security.privateca.v1beta1.ReusableConfigWrapper] describes values that may assist in creating an X.509 certificate, or a reference to a pre-defined set of values.

Inheritance
System.Object
ReusableConfigWrapper
Implements
IMessage<ReusableConfigWrapper>
System.IEquatable<ReusableConfigWrapper>
IDeepCloneable<ReusableConfigWrapper>
Google.Protobuf.IBufferMessage
IMessage
Inherited Members
System.Object.ToString()
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
Namespace: Google.Cloud.Security.PrivateCA.V1Beta1
Assembly: Google.Cloud.Security.PrivateCA.V1Beta1.dll
Syntax
public sealed class ReusableConfigWrapper : IMessage<ReusableConfigWrapper>, IEquatable<ReusableConfigWrapper>, IDeepCloneable<ReusableConfigWrapper>, IBufferMessage, IMessage

Constructors

ReusableConfigWrapper()

Declaration
public ReusableConfigWrapper()

ReusableConfigWrapper(ReusableConfigWrapper)

Declaration
public ReusableConfigWrapper(ReusableConfigWrapper other)
Parameters
Type Name Description
ReusableConfigWrapper other

Properties

ConfigValuesCase

Declaration
public ReusableConfigWrapper.ConfigValuesOneofCase ConfigValuesCase { get; }
Property Value
Type Description
ReusableConfigWrapper.ConfigValuesOneofCase

ReusableConfig

Required. A resource path to a [ReusableConfig][google.cloud.security.privateca.v1beta1.ReusableConfig] in the format projects/*/locations/*/reusableConfigs/*.

Declaration
public string ReusableConfig { get; set; }
Property Value
Type Description
System.String

ReusableConfigValues

Required. A user-specified inline [ReusableConfigValues][google.cloud.security.privateca.v1beta1.ReusableConfigValues].

Declaration
public ReusableConfigValues ReusableConfigValues { get; set; }
Property Value
Type Description
ReusableConfigValues
Back to top